# Stanford EE364A: Convex Optimization
|
||||
|
||||
## Descriptions
|
||||
|
||||
- Offered by: Stanford
|
||||
- Prerequisites: Python, Calculus, Linear Algebra, Probability Theory, Numerical Analysis
|
||||
- Programming Languages: Python
|
||||
- Difficulty: 🌟🌟🌟🌟🌟
|
||||
- Class Hour: 150 hours
|
||||
|
||||
Professor [Stephen Boyd](http://web.stanford.edu/~boyd) is a great expert in the field of convex optimization and his textbook **Convex Optimization** has been adopted by many prestigious universities. His team has also developed a programming framework for solving common convex optimization problems in Python, Julia, and other popular programming languages, and its homework assignments also use this programming framework to solve real-life convex optimization problems.
|
||||
|
||||
In practice, you will deeply understand that for the same problem, a small change in the modeling process can make a world of difference in the difficulty of solving the equation. It is an art to make the equations you formulate "convex".
